Addicted to Fun: Overcoming Drug Addiction

Drug addiction can be a challenge to overcome but with the right support and strategies, it can be done. Taking the right steps to help someone overcome drug addiction can make a big difference in the person’s life. Here are some tips to help someone overcome drug addiction:

  • Recognize the problem. It’s important to take the time to sit down and honestly assess the situation. Recognize the problem and make a plan of action to move forward.

  • Find a support system. Find a supportive and trusted friend or family member to talk to. They can provide emotional support and help brainstorm ways to tackle the addiction.

  • Seek professional help. There are plenty of specialized professionals and organizations that can help with drug addiction. Talk to a doctor or therapist and explore the many options available to help break the addiction.

Crafting a Path to a Drug-Free Life

Once a person has recognized the problem and found a support team, the next step is to start crafting a path to a drug-free life. Here are some tips to start on that journey:

  • Develop a plan. It’s important to have a plan of action to stay on track and reach the goal. Create a list of tasks, such as attending therapy sessions, engaging in activities that distract from drug use, and avoiding drug use triggers.

  • Start with small changes. Don’t try to tackle the addiction all at once; start with small goals and work up from there. Remember that it’s a long-term process and every small victory should be celebrated.

  • Stay positive. Drug addiction can be a challenge, and it can be easy to get discouraged. Stay positive and keep going even when things seem hard.
